Useful swaps

  • Make two peanut chicken casseroles: Bake 70 g rinsed basmati with 110 g boiling water at 425°F for 10 minutes. Whisk 21 g peanut butter, 70 g coconut milk, 14 g vegan curry paste, 12 g lime, 10 g soy, 5 g ginger, and 20 g water. Divide rice, 180 g chicken, 90 g broccoli, 70 g pepper, and sauce between two small covered dishes; bake 12 minutes covered and 3 minutes uncovered to 165°F. Rest 5 minutes and add 6 g lime and 8 g cilantro. Dietary pattern is unchanged. Major allergens are unchanged; check packaged ingredients for cross-contact.   • Make a saucy peanut chicken rice bake: Put 70 g rinsed basmati and 110 g boiling water in a covered dish and bake at 425°F for 10 minutes. Whisk 21 g peanut butter, 70 g coconut milk, 14 g vegan curry paste, 12 g lime, 10 g soy, 5 g ginger, and 40 g water; pour over 180 g chicken, 90 g broccoli, and 70 g pepper on the rice. Bake 12 minutes covered and 3 minutes uncovered to 165°F, rest 5 minutes, and add 6 g lime and 8 g cilantro. Dietary pattern is unchanged. Storage and reheating

  • Refrigerate for up to 4 days.
  • Freezer-friendly for up to 30 days.
  • Suggested reheating: Microwave, Oven.
